About the role:
The Senior Project Officer is located within the Centre for Victorian Data Linkage, Victoria's specialist data linkage agency. CVDL acquires and links together 40 plus administrative and clinical datasets for policy development and research purposes. CVDL acquires identifying information from multiple datasets to undertake its linkage function and stores this information within a specialist Azure linkage and integration infrastructure. CVDL also provides analysts and researchers with project specific access to deidentified linked data within the secure access environment, VALT.
The purpose of this role is to support the design, development, and operation of CVDL's data infrastructure, focusing on VALT. This role assists with implementing and maintaining VALT's Azure cloud infrastructure and delivering secure and scalable data solutions. The Senior Project Officer collaborates with IT staff and stakeholders to ensure the platform meets objectives and maintains high security, reliability, and privacy standards.
